    Don't mean to rain on your parade but there isn't actually a resource yet.

    No doubt Vale did their due diligance and wanted to get in on some ground in that area. So I see that as a big approval coming from a major.

    The reason that Vale wanted to farm in is due to the ground position GMX hold. It has absolutely squat to do with the company/management etc.

    Vale obviously are looking at getting into exploration for copper/gold porphyries and identified that GMX hold some prospective ground in a commodity that they want to get into.

    Talking of mining at this stage is more than optimistic. There is good exploration potential here, and even if there is huge success on the ground MGX will never see it through to a mining stage.

    If they do discover a significant resource MGX will get taken out very quickly. A major would not sit on a significant resource and allow a junior to be free carried 30% all the way through.

    I bought into these guys as I like the ground and Vale provides a stamp of approval.

    I also wanted to add, just because a major agrees to farm into a project, does not mean that there will be a resource there. Major's make wrong decisions too. But it does show that a large mining company has enough confidence in the potential of that particular region to get in on the ground.
